PricewaterhouseCoopers Advisory Services LLC Manager, Delivering Deal Value (Multiple Positions) in Seattle, Washington
Manager, Delivering Deal Value (Multiple Positions), PricewaterhouseCoopers Advisory Services LLC, Seattle, WA. Assist clients achieve maximum value on their deal transactions by solving transformational and complex challenges through operational aspects of a transaction, pre and post completion. Conduct pre deal and confirmatory due diligence, execute large scale enterprise-wide integrations, and support complex divestitures and separations on a wide range of functional areas. Help clients solve their complex business issues from strategy to execution. Supervise and coach professional teams.
40 hrs/week, Mon-Fri, 8:30 a.m. - 5:30 p.m.
The salary range is $171,000 - $179,000, plus individuals may be eligible for an annual discretionary bonus. PwC offers medical, dental, vision, 401k, holiday pay, vacation and more. For information, please visit the following link: https://pwc.to/benefits-at-a-glance.{rel="nofollow"}
[M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S]{.underline}[:]{.underline}
Must have a Bachelor's degree or foreign equivalent in Accounting, Finance, Engineering, Information Technology, Management Information Systems, or a related field, plus 5 years of post-bachelor's, progressive related work experience.
In the alternative, the employer will accept a Master's degree or foreign equivalent in Accounting, Finance, Engineering, Information Technology, Management Information Systems, or a related field, plus 3 years of related work experience.
Must have at least one year of experience with each of the following:
- Experience with Mergers, Acquisitions and Divestitures including pre-deal operations and information technology due diligence, integration planning, separation planning, synergy and cost savings analysis, and/or post-close transformation, with knowledge of one or more of the following functional areas: Information Technology, Human Resources, Finance, Operations/Supply Chain, and/or Sales and Marketing;
- Conducting resource requirements, project workflow, budgets and status updates;
- Utilizing data visualization tools such as Tableau, Power BI and/or Qlikview as well as the Microsoft suite of applications such as Excel, Word, PowerPoint, Visio, and/or Project; and
- Conducting quantitative and qualitative analyses of complex data.
80% telecommuting permitted. Must be able to commute to the designated local office.
Travel requirement(s): Domestic and/or international travel up to 80% is required.
